Description

The PISO-P8R8U card is the new generation card is designed as a direct drop-in replacement for the PISO-P8R8, without the need for software/driver modification.


The PISO-P8R8U universal PCI card supports 3.3 V/5 V PCI bus. This card provides 8-channels of optically isolated DI and 8-channels of electromechanical relay outputs.

These DI channels provide 3750 Vrms isolation protection that allow the input signals to be completely floated so as to prevent ground loops while also isolating the host computer from damaging voltages. Relays are used where necessary to control a circuit using a low-power signal (with complete electrical isolation between the control and controlled circuits), or where several circuits must be controlled using one signal. The PISO-P8R8U can be used in varous applications, such as controlling the ON/OFF state of external devices, driving external relays or small power switches, activating alarms, contact closure, sensing external voltages or switches, etc. The card contains a single DB-37 connector for easy wiring.


The PISO-P8R8U also adds a Card ID switch on-board. Users can set Card ID and then recognize the board by the ID via software when using two or more PIO-P8R8U cards in one computer.

These cards support various OS versions, such as Linux, DOS, Windows 98/NT/2000 and 32/64-bit Windows 7/Vista/XP. DLL and Active X control together with various language sample programs based on Turbo C++, Borland C++, Microsoft C++, Visual C++, Borland Delphi, Borland C++ Builder, Visual Basic, C#.NET, Visual Basic.NET and LabVIEW are provided in order to help users quickly and easily develop their own applications.

Includes one CA-4002 D-Sub connector.

NOTE: Compared to PCI-P8R8, the PISO-P8R8 has all form A relays rather than 50/50 Form A/FormC with higher current output rating on a shorter PCB.

Specifications

Digital Input

Isolation Voltage

5000 Vrms (Photo-couple)

Channels

8

Input Voltage

Logic 1:AC/DC 5 ~ 24 V(AC 50 ~ 1 kHz)
Logic 0: AC/DC 0 ~ 1 V

Input Impedance

1.2 KΩ, 1 W

Response Speed

Without Filter: 50 kHz (Typical)
With Filter: 0.455 kHz(Typical)

Relay Output

Channels

8

Relay Type

SPST N.O.(Form A)

Contact Rating

AC: 250 V@1.6 A
DC: 30 V@5 A

Operate Time

6 ms (typical)

Release Time

3 ms (typical)

Insulation Resistance

1000 MΩ @ 500 VDC

Life

Mechanical: 2,000,000 ops.
Electrical: 100,000 ops.

General

Bus Type

3.3 V/5 V Universal PCI, 32-bit, 33 MHz

Data Bus

8-bit

Card ID

Yes (4-bit)

I/O Connector

Female DB37 x 1

Dimensions (L x W x D)

149 mm x 105 mm x 22 mm

Power Consumption

300 mA @ +5 V

Operating Temperature

0 ~ 60 °C

Storage Temperature

-20 ~ 70 °C

Humidity

5 ~ 85% RH, non-condensing
